If the madVR output levels are set to ‘TV levels (16-235)’:
In CalMAN, for ‘Input Signal Levels,’ select ‘Video (16-235).’
If the madVR output levels are set to ‘PC levels (0-255)’:
In CalMAN, for ‘Input Signal Levels,’ select ‘PC (0-255).’
2. Display Pre-Test section
In the ‘Display Pre-Test’ section of the Color Cube workflow, you can measure the performance of a
display before you calibrate it, on the Gamma & ColorChecker page and on the Advanced Linearity page.
CAUTION: While CalMAN is running, it disables any existing 3D LUT in madVR, by default.
If there is already a 3D LUT loaded in madVR and you wish to first measure the performance of
the display with that 3D LUT, you need to enable the LUT during your display Pre-
Characterization steps.
To enable an existing madVR LUT:
On the CalMAN Source Settings tab, check the box for “Enable 3D LUT.”
(The button on the madVR Test Pattern Generator screen will not be active.)
The text at the top of the Test Pattern Generator screen indicates the status of any installed
madVR 3D LUT.
On the Performance Analysis page, the display measurements from the Gamma & ColorChecker page
are evaluated in a series of pass/fail performance parameters.
If the display fails any of the parameters on the Performance Analysis page, you should consider
using the following Display Optimization section of the workflow to optimize control adjustments on
the display itself.
If the display passes all of the parameters on the Performance Analysis page, you can skip the
Display Optimization section and go immediately to the Display Calibration section of the workflow.
